Independance Day Celebration
Love Dale Central school celebrated Independence Day with great fervour and patriotism. The students of 8th along with their teachers put up a colorful and heart touching program.
The program was started with the unfurling of the Nation Tricolor by Chief Guest Col. Sanjiv Kumar Prasad (Commanding Officer, Military Hospital, Belgaum) and was followed by a patriotic program consisting of speeches, songs, dance and a skit called “Bhagat Singh ke sapno ka Bharat”. The Chief Guest gave an inspiring speech urging students to become good citizens of India. The Principal, co-ordinators, teachers and students all contributed towards the grand success of the program.
